Understanding Web3 APIs
The term Web3 refers to the third generation of the World Wide Web, focused on decentralization and the user’s control over their data. At its core, Web3 API integration allows applications to communicate with blockchain networks effortlessly, enabling developers to build more intuitive and robust solutions.
In the heart of these developments lies the concept of APIs (Application Programming Interfaces). APIs facilitate the interaction between software applications, allowing developers to harness functionality without building from scratch. The integration of Web3 APIs follows suit, allowing for easier access to smart contracts, decentralized applications (DApps), and transactions.

The Power of Web3 APIs
- Streamlining Development: Web3 APIs simplify complex processes, making it easier to implement blockchain functionalities.
- Increased Interoperability: APIs connect different blockchains, allowing users and applications to interact across various platforms.
- Real-Time Data Access: Developers can access blockchain data in real-time, enabling more responsive applications.

A Roadmap for Integration
To effectively implement Web3 API integration, businesses should consider the following steps:
- Define Objectives: Clearly outline what you want to achieve through Web3 integration.
- Choose the Right API: Research and select APIs that align with your needs—whether that’s transaction processing, data retrieval, or smart contract execution.
- Develop a Prototype: Create a minimum viable product and iterate based on user feedback.
- Test Rigorously: Perform comprehensive testing to identify any potential vulnerabilities in your integrated system.
Future Trends in Web3 API Integration
As we move towards 2025, the blockchain ecosystem will continue evolving, potentially introducing new paradigms concerning decentralization, governance, and security. One emerging trend is the rise of cross-chain technologies that leverage Web3 APIs for greater interoperability between different blockchain networks. Such advancements will allow users to seamlessly transact across platforms without hindering security.
